Transaction 75ddafa3932b428287196332731f1051bbe1547ce1dcd3b8d1aeb7ec46f7d671

1 Input
2 Outputs
  • 75ddafa3932b428287196332731f1051bbe1547ce1dcd3b8d1aeb7ec46f7d671:0
  • value  772505736
    address  3PurvdcaAWugrCJacRJzhHeFsnDdkTVZWS
  • 75ddafa3932b428287196332731f1051bbe1547ce1dcd3b8d1aeb7ec46f7d671:1
  • value  12484800
    address  16sTr2RqpthWicEjsjbnmJxmjtnKNUKZKK